#419676 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#419676 is composed of 25.5% red, 58.8% green and 46.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 21.3%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 157.4 degrees, a saturation of 39.5% and a lightness of 42.2%. #419676 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ffec with #002d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#419676 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#419676 has RGB values of R:65, G:150, B:118 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.21,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 4298358.

Hex triplet 419676 #419676
RGB Decimal 65, 150, 118 rgb(65,150,118)
RGB Percent 25.5, 58.8, 46.3 rgb(25.5%,58.8%,46.3%)
CMYK 57, 0, 21, 41
HSL 157.4°, 39.5, 42.2 hsl(157.4,39.5%,42.2%)
HSV (or HSB) 157.4°, 56.7, 58.8
Web Safe 339966 #339966
CIE-LAB 56.331, -33.665, 9.235
XYZ 16.355, 24.243, 20.956
xyY 0.266, 0.394, 24.243
CIE-LCH 56.331, 34.908, 164.66
CIE-LUV 56.331, -36.703, 17.819
Hunter-Lab 49.237, -26.873, 9.232
Binary 01000001, 10010110, 01110110
